MPVolumeView相当于Android

时间:2014-02-27 12:43:11

标签: android bluetooth android-bluetooth mpvolumeview

有人知道Android中是否有等效的MPVolumeView吗?

基本上,它是iOS中的内置组件,可以为用户提供系统音量滑块,和/或(我在Android中真正关注的)可用蓝牙/ Airplay音频输出选项列表(即蓝牙音箱) 。下图显示了它的实际效果:

MPVolumeView listing available audio output routes

是否有任何简单的选项可以在Android中列出蓝牙等音频路由选项,或者您是否必须自己编写所有扫描,连接,音频路由代码?

1 个答案:

答案 0 :(得分:1)

由于缺乏响应,以及围绕连接到A2DP蓝牙接收器的主题的无休止的谷歌搜索,我最近一直在做,这个问题的悲伤答案似乎是没有,没有什么比MPVolumeView更像机器人。

最接近的事情是要么自己写一下,就像我担心的那样,或者只是从你的应用程序中弹出系统蓝牙选项窗口(确保你的清单中设置了BLUETOOTH_ADMIN权限第一):

Intent intentOpenBluetoothSettings = new Intent();
intentOpenBluetoothSettings.setAction(android.provider.Settings.ACTION_BLUETOOTH_SETTINGS); 
startActivity(intentOpenBluetoothSettings);